How they compare
Turkey currently reports 1.5% against 1.3% in Norway, a difference of 0.2%.
That makes Turkey's figure about 1.2 times Norway's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 16 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Turkey ahead.
Norway ranks 135th and Turkey ranks 132nd of 169 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Norway averaged higher in 1 and Turkey in 2.
